2016 Chevrolet Sonic Bolt Pattern
Checking fitment for your vehicle? Below you will find the factory bolt pattern (also known as the lug pattern) for the 2016 Chevrolet Sonic, along with offset and center bore data.
| Bolt Pattern (Lug Pattern) | 5x105 |
|---|---|
| Lug Nut / Bolt Size | N 12x1.50 |
| Center Bore (CB) | 56.6 mm |
| Offset (ET) | 40 |
| Torque Specs | 80 ft-lbs (108 Nm) |
2016 Sonic — Year-Specific Fitment Context
The 2016 Chevrolet Sonic is in year 5 of 9 using the 5x105 pattern (2012–2020). Wheels from any 2012–2020 Chevrolet Sonic are cross-compatible with the 2016 model.

Expert Buying Guide for 2016 Chevrolet Sonic
When selecting wheels for your 2016 Chevrolet Sonic, the 5x105 bolt pattern is shared with all 2012–2020 Sonic models, ensuring cross-compatibility. However, the 56.6mm center bore is critical: aftermarket wheels often have a larger bore, requiring hub-centric rings to prevent vibration and ensure proper load distribution. Offset is sensitive; the factory spec is 40mm, and deviations beyond ±5mm may cause rubbing or clearance issues. Always verify lug nut fitment: the Sonic uses M12x1.50 threads with a conical (60-degree) seat. Using incorrect seat types (e.g., ball seat) can lead to wheel loosening. Safety first: improper fitment compromises handling and braking.

2016 Chevrolet Sonic — Frequently Asked Questions
What is the bolt pattern for a 2016 Chevrolet Sonic?
The 2016 Chevrolet Sonic uses a 5x105 bolt pattern (also called lug pattern or PCD). The center bore is 56.6mm and the offset is 40mm.
What other years of Chevrolet Sonic have the same bolt pattern as the 2016?
The Chevrolet Sonic uses the 5x105 pattern from 2012 through 2020. Wheels from any of these model years are dimensionally compatible with the 2016, provided the offset and center bore also match.
Why is matching the 56.6mm center bore important for the 2016 Sonic?
The 56.6mm center bore ensures the wheel is perfectly centered on the hub. If the wheel is lug-centric instead of hub-centric, you may experience steering wheel vibration at highway speeds.
What is the PCD for a 2016 Chevrolet Sonic?
PCD stands for Pitch Circle Diameter, which is the same as the bolt pattern. For the 2016 Sonic, the PCD is 5x105.
Can I use spacers on my 2016 Chevrolet Sonic?
Yes, but ensure the wheel spacers match the 5x105 bolt pattern and 56.6mm center bore. Also verify that you have enough thread engagement for your N 12x1.50 hardware.
How do I measure the bolt pattern on my 2016 Chevrolet?
The 2016 Sonic uses a 5x105 pattern. For 4, 6, or 8-lug wheels, measure center-to-center across opposite holes. For 5-lug, measure from the center of one hole to the back of the opposite hole.
